A heat resistant tile is a tile designed to withstand high temperatures and reduce the transfer of heat into the building. These tiles are manufactured using materials that have low thermal conductivity and high solar reflectance. Instead of absorbing heat like regular concrete or dark-colored tiles, heat resistant tiles reflect a significant portion of sunlight and slow down heat penetration. This keeps terrace surfaces cooler and helps maintain a comfortable indoor temperature. What Type of Tile Is Heat Resistant? There is no single tile that fits all requirements. Different types of tiles offer heat resistance based on material, manufacturing method, and surface treatment. Heat Resistant Concrete Tiles Heat resistant concrete tiles are one of the most commonly used solutions for terraces and rooftops. These tiles are manufactured using special concrete mixes that include heat-reflective aggregates and additives. Cool Roof Tiles (Reflective Tiles) Cool roof tiles are designed with high solar reflectance and thermal emittance. These tiles are usually light in color and coated with reflective materials. Thermal Insulation Terrace Tiles Thermal insulation tiles are specially developed to block heat transfer. These tiles often include insulating layers or materials within the tile structure. Clay-Based Heat Resistant Tiles Clay tiles are naturally heat resistant due to their porous structure and natural composition. When used correctly on terraces, they can help regulate temperature. How Heat Resistant Tiles Work Heat resistant tiles work through a combination of: Solar reflection Thermal insulation Reduced heat absorption Controlled heat transfer By minimizing the amount of heat entering the building, these tiles create a cooler indoor environment naturally. Why Heat Resistant Tiles Are Important for Terraces Terraces receive the maximum amount of direct sunlight.
